Beskrivelse
Focuses on the 3 major humanitarian operations in which Swedes were involved during WWII; the Red Cross mission in Greece, Raoul Wallenberg's and other Swedes efforts to save the Jews of Budapest and Folke Bernadotte's White Bus operation in 1945. He also looks at the first Swedish reactions when they were confronted by former concentration camp prisoners and the changing attitude to Wallenberg and Folke Bernadotte.
